Transaction 90279feba849aad19d4505a360fe614073a318dae2b8252e047b50660beebafc

1 Input
1 Outputs
  • 90279feba849aad19d4505a360fe614073a318dae2b8252e047b50660beebafc:0
  • value  3251315
    address  1624PE6EL28sqgXtm339Kj2272vAKJHJvx